Martin Mill station is equipped with a range of practical amenities to facilitate your travel. For commuters and occasional travelers alike, a ticket machine on platform 1 assists in ticket collection, caters to accessibility needs, and includes an induction loop to aid the hearing impaired. Although the ticket office is open only during weekday mornings, from 06:10 to 10:30, it provides essential support during peak hours. Collecting tickets purchased online is straightforward here, further enhancing a hassle-free experience.
While relaxation options here may be sparse, with no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, there is adequate seating available. However, amenities like accessible toilets, bicycle storage, and refreshment facilities are notably absent, so it's wise to plan accordingly.
Martin Mill station promotes accessibility with step-free access to platform 1, though the adjoining platform 2 requires navigating stairs, which may impact those with mobility challenges. For passengers requiring assistance, the station staff are available on weekdays between 06:10-10:30, with customer help points readily available. Additionally, Southeastern's assistance program ensures seamless transitions, even arranging complimentary taxi services to prevent travel disruptions.

Heath High Level lacks a ticket office but compensates with ticket machines for collecting online purchases. Accessibility is a priority, although the station isn’t entirely wheelchair-friendly, with step-free access only partially available. Ticket machines accommodate major debit and credit cards, ensuring convenience for travellers. Despite the absence of a waiting room, you'll find seating areas to make your wait a little more comfortable.
On-site amenities are sparse, with no refreshments, ATMs, or public Wi-Fi available. The station does provide CCTV security and customer help points, enhancing safety for all passengers. For further queries or assistance, staff are accessible through help points, or you can reach out via the Transport for Wales website.
Travel doesn't stop at the tracks at Heath High Level. When trains aren't an option, a rail replacement service is available at the station entrance—ideal for those last-minute travel plan changes. While there's no bicycle storage at the station, you can take advantage of the bicycle hire services provided by Next/Ovo bike nearby, perfect for a leisurely ride around Cardiff.
